Congratulations to the Trojans on their 4th sweep of an SEOAL team.......Portsmouth is 8-0 vs. Logan, Gallia Academy, Jackson, and Marietta........a first for PHS.

This game was eerily similar to the game at Logan.......same margin, almost the same number of points, and a game where the Chieftains kept fighting back........they came from 53-35 down to within 6 at 62-56 early in the 4th quarter. Jordan Rutter, Mason Mays, and Patrick Angle carried LHS offensively, but I actually thought the Trojans did a better job on Angle this time around.......they made him put the ball on the floor more and didn't give him as many open looks from the perimeter.

As we head into the tournament, Portsmouth has to do a better job at putting teams away and not let them hang around.......last night the Trojans were outstanding at times but average at other points which allowed LHS to get back in the game.

Tory Horne had his 3rd game above 30 points for PHS.......he is averaging 25.4 PPG going into tonight's game with Ironton........the school record for a single season average is 25.5 PPG by Larry Hisle in 1965.

Dion McKinley was dominant in the paint.......this sophomore continues to get better and better and has shown good discipline of not getting in foul trouble even with his ability to block or alter shots.......Forrest Johnson had a very good offensive night, which was good for him and the team.......FJ had been fairly quiet scoring wise the last several games so it was good to see him with a 15 point night.

London Malone proved to be steady and reliable at the point, and once again he hit a key 3 pointer as the Chieftains were making their rally.......he is also an excellent FT shooter. Tre Underwood made some nice post moves for buckets and as always hit the boards with tenacity.

I'm glad to see the coaches hold Wayne Evans out.......I want him fully healthy for the Valley game.......

Good win for the Trojans to go to 11-6 on the year and 9-4 in the SEOAL.......a win over Ironton on Saturday would give the Trojans a 10 win season in the league and a finish of no worse than a tie for 3rd.......and the highest regular season winning pct.(12-6, .667) since the 2001 season, when PHS went 15-4. The 2002 team posted a 13-7 RS mark.
